What can I see and do near Gifu City Museum of History?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at Nagaragawa Ukai Museum, Gifu City Science Museum or Museum of Fine Arts. Learn about local history at Gifu Castle and Kawara-machi Historic Street. You can wander around Gifu Park, Oasis Park or Bairin Park if you want a dose of fresh air.
